The M-Pact Agilite Edition was the result of a collaboration between Agilite, Israel’s top tactical gear company and Mechanix Wear, the world leader in tactical hand protection.  They teamed up back in 2017 to develop a unique glove that meets the needs of Israeli Tier 1 SOF who wanted the best of all worlds, the protection of a Mechanix M-Pact Covert glove but the tactile capabilities of a fingerless glove.

Agilite’s distribution company (Agilite Ergonomics Ltd.) and Mechanix partner since 2015 worked closely with Israel Police and Army SOF units as well as IDF Ground Forces Command who were looking for a hybrid tactical glove with just three fingers exposed and other unique features for better performance.

The MPACT Agilite edition has already been issued unit-wide in several Israeli Army and Police SOF units in both Multicam and Black but has not been available commercially in black till now.

SpearUAV Expands its Ninox Family, Unveiling the Ninox 40 Handheld – a Revolutionary Encapsulated Drone System for Immediate Manual Launch

October 7th, 2020

For the first time ever, immediate ISTAR capabilities are available to any soldier, law enforcement officer or homeland security personnel, independent of any other equipment.

7 October 2020.  SpearUAV – an innovative company that develops and supplies unique UAS solutions for defense and HLS applications – is unveiling its handheld version of the Ninox 40 that was unveiled just two months ago. This revolutionary encapsulated drone system offers instant launch and provides immediate intelligence capabilities to any tactical unit, even if it is not equipped with a 40 mm grenade launcher or any other special equipment.

With its unique launching system, the Ninox40 Handheld can now provide advanced capabilities to various law enforcement agencies, such as police – for use in public safety and law & order applications, prison services – for management of any disorder or prison break attempt, border guards – for situational awareness and securing sensitive infrastructure, and more.

Like the Ninox 40 micro-tactical drone system, the Ninox 40 Handheld requires no deployment. The system comprises an encapsulated drone and control unit; when launched at high speed, the drone immediately unfolds and stabilizes in the air, with no operator intervention required.

Specifically designed for single-user operation and weighing under 250 g – within regulatory limitations – it is lightweight enough to be carried in the soldier’s vest during combat. Advantages include:

Mission flexibility – Ninox 40 Handheld systems can be carried by any number of users in a unit, according to mission requirements, delivering full ISTAR capability without being dependent on any other weapon or special equipment.

Safe and intuitive – the Ninox 40 Handheld is easy to use without any special training.

Ready for immediate use – the fully-ruggedized launch capsule can be carried in a vest or in a vehicle, or stored as is, remaining ready for immediate launch on the field during a mission, without any specific maintenance or preparations being required.

The Ninox 40 Handheld has a flight capacity of up to 40 minutes, extensive ISTAR capabilities, day and night camera for enhanced situational awareness, automatic tracking, and can be launched on the move and from under cover.

“The new Ninox 40 Handheld joins the Ninox family of unique capsule drones, all of which feature breakthrough technology developed in-house at SpearUAV, with the aim of changing the battlefield and giving ground forces advanced and immediate capabilities,” says Gadi Kuperman, Founder and CEO of SpearUAV. “This is the first drone in the world to be manually launched from a capsule, giving both combat soldiers HLS forces and law enforcement personnel situational awareness in a matter of seconds, for any mission in the field. We continue to develop the system to meet the specific needs of our customers, and new versions are already undergoing field testing.”

Virtual Warfighter Expo – Rohde & Schwarz Compact Direction Finder

October 7th, 2020

I don’t get to write about electronic warfare equipment very often, but it’s always fun when I do.

The R&S DDF1555 Compact Direction Finder can be configured for spectrum search, signal monitoring and mobile as well as static direction finding. There is even an option for internal recording of signals.

It can be used with a variety of end user devices and depending on receivers installed, will receive signals from 9 kHz to 7.5 GHz and DF signals from 20 MHz to 6 GHz. Likewise, the system uses either the correlative interferometer or Watson-Watt method for DF solutions. There are a variety of antennas available for use, depending on the application.

The system weighs just shy of 9 lbs and utilizes a BB-2590 type battery which delivers up to 10 hours of DF operation.

Virtual Warfighter Expo – AN/PRC-148E Spear from Thales

October 7th, 2020

The Thales AN/PRC-148E Spear Single Channel Handheld Radio is their latest version of the famed Multiband Inter/Intra Team Radio (MBITR).

It offers the same functionality of the AN/PRC-148 JEM in a reduced size.

Size: 8.5″ x 3.2″ x 1.1″ and 1.26 lbs with battery.

(The AN/PRC-148 is 8.44″ x 2.63″ x 1.52″ and weighs ~1.9 lbs.)

Waveforms/Modes of Operation Available:
-MIL-STD-188-241-1/-2
(SINCGARS — Standard/FH2 EOM)
-MIL-STD-188-181C, -182B, -183B (SATCOM IW)
-HAVEQUICK I and II
-ANDVT (LPC-10, MELP) AM/FM
-Project 25
-Over-The-Air-Cloning (OTAC)
-Situational Awareness Retransmission
-AM Swept Tone Beacon

Additionally, it incorporates a Type-1 Certified Programmable Encryption Engine (AIM).

Narrowband Channel

Frequency Range: 30 MHz–512 MHz

Transmit Power: 5 watt in all frequencies, 10 watt in SATCOM

Step Size: 5 kHz and 6.25 kHz

Channel Bandwidth: 5 kHz, 12.5 kHz, 25 kHz (8.33 kHz future waveform)

PHLster Announces Summit OWB Holster

October 7th, 2020

After a decade of making inside-the-waistband holsters, PHLster has incorporated the range of adjustment and the concealment principles present in their AIWB holsters into a brand new outside-the-waistband concealment holster.

The new Summit OWB holster, using a unique belt attachment system, allows the end-user to fine-tune their holster to reduce printing and accommodate the specifics of their body type or mission.

Each holster comes with a pair of trimmable wedges. The wedges control the relationship between the holster and the belt, allowing you to angle the gun inward, for maximum concealment, or outward, to accommodate your body shape or to clear concealable body armor.

Grip rotation, to mitigate printing, is accomplished by setting up an offset between the leading and trailing edges of the holster. Using the thick part of the wedge on the slide side, and the thin part of the wedge on the trigger guard side, tightening the belt will pull the grip inward. If you have experience with one of the many IWB holsters that have a wing or a claw, you’ll already be familiar with this principle. For maximum concealment, you can set up the Summit with the trigger-side belt loop and wedge on the face of the holster, for more aggressive grip rotation, just like your AIWB wing-equipped holster.

We’ve also improved OWB holster belt loops. Many pancake-style OWB holsters fall short in terms of concealment because they can’t accommodate a wide range of waist shapes. Our new high-strength, slim, composite polymer wings are strong enough to survive any violent physical encounter or hard use. And they’re rigid enough to transfer the necessary belt forces to accomplish concealment, while also being forgiving enough to fit your body shape like a custom holster. Like a quality leather holster, they’ll break in to fit you perfectly, but they won’t get weaker or softer.

The base of the Summit holster is an ambidextrous, compression formed, pancake holster shell, meticulously designed to give you firm, crisp, and deliberate non-adjustable retention. With an unobtrusive mid-ride body shield on both sides, the holster accommodates optics, suppressor sights, and muzzle devices.

At launch the Summit is available in two models. One for G19/17/34 and the other for G43/43x/48 (MOS compatible). Light bearing models and additional fits are forthcoming.

Virtual Warfighter Expo – TacMed R-AID Bag

October 7th, 2020

The Tactical Medical Solutions R-AID Bag worn as a backpack, hung as a panel, or slung over a shoulder like a messenger bag.

All critical intervention items are loaded in the top flap of the bag for immediate access. The second main compartment of these combat med pack bags contain items required for additional treatments and casualty packaging. The rear sleeve contains triage and casualty marking materials.

Offered in Black, Green, MultiCam, Tan and Red.
